DISCUSSION:
The purpose of this memo is to clarify policy regarding a formal review of a resource home.
When there is a substantiated determination of child abuse/neglect involving a resource home and/or there are serious infractions of licensing regulations, a formal review should be conducted. The purpose of the review is to determine the continued use or licensure of the resource home. The Regional Director/Designee should facilitate the formal review.
The formal review of a resource home is a separate process from the Fair Hearing process. The formal review shall be completed before implementing the Fair Hearing process. The outcome of a formal review of a resource home may result in proceeding with an adverse action of the resource home license which will begin the Fair Hearing Process.
An outline for the written formal review summary has been added to policy.
Revisions have been made to the document used for the Fair Hearing process, Resource Home Adverse Action Report, CS-20, and the CS-20 instructions.
